Western AI Models Fail on Local Crops and Forests in Global South
Source: rest-of-world
AI tools developed by major Western tech companies are struggling to perform reliably in agricultural and forestry contexts outside the West, often failing to recognise local crops, tree species, or farming conditions. The models, trained predominantly on Western data, require significant adaptation to be useful in African, Asian, and Latin American environments. Experts warn this data gap risks deepening the digital divide in food security and land management.
